I been finesse fishing for couple years now, most of the gear I have is ultralight stuff, and med rods for salmon runs during the season (also finesse). Most of the time I'm fishing for dinks on super ultralight but I want to make the change to stocked trout so I can just sit back and relax for once and shoot the shit with friends. So I bought 2 of these rods just to rig it up with Carolina rig and use Berkley powerbaits/eggs. 1/2 oz weight was heavy and had hard time loading the rod and line kept breaking (5.5 lb braid with 4 lb leader). So I switched to 3/16 oz bullet weights and it's impossible to cast in windy conditions. Also I'm skeptical with lure weights on this UL rod, 1/2 seems too much for any UL right to handle. I just rigged up 3/8 oz weight but haven't tested it but it's bowing the tip. I looked few videos on the toob but none of them is mentioning the rods power. Anyways I digress, I need a rod recommendations for stocked trout in lakes that's willing to chuck 1/2 or 3/4 oz easily to cover the distance. Any help is appreciated.
